2. Helical Slab Repair
When faced with settling, broken concrete floors in your basement or garage, slab piers can solve
the problem.
Steel helical piers are installed into the soil under the slab to transfer the weight of the slab to
competent load-bearing strata (soil) or bedrock. Once the piers are installed, you can also lift the
slab back to a level position.
Slab piers allow you to fix your settled slab quickly, without the need to remove the existing slab and
any walls in the area. Heavy-duty steel brackets are attached to the failed slab and steel piers
driven beneath to stable soil strata. Utilizing hydraulic equipment, the concrete slab is lifted to the
appropriate level, stabilized and the bracket is removed.

Why concrete sinks...
There can be many reasons as to why concrete sinks: improper compaction of soils during or after
the building process, water intrusion from bad drainage, and natural settlement.
Soils consist of solid particles and the spaces (voids) between these particles. However, void spaces
in soil can cause big problems for buildings and concrete slabs. Concentrated loads, such as
buildings or slabs, can literally squeeze air and water from soils. When this happens, the soil sinks
and the buildings or slabs follow closely behind.
Mudjacking / Concrete Lifting Solutions For St. Louis Area
Owners
Many times we can solve sunken concrete problems using a process called mudjacking. (Also called
void filling or pressure grouting).
Holes are strategically drilled into the slab. Using a portable pump and flexible hoses, we fill these
holes with the special mixture. Lifting a slab using this method can often be accomplished in a few
hours.
